谷氨酰胺联合维生素C对热应激致大鼠肠源性内毒素血症的预防作用  被引量:4

Preventive effect of glutamine combined with vitamin C on intestinal endotoxemia induced by heat stress in rats

摘  要:目的观察谷氨酰胺联合维生素C对肠源性内毒血症的预防作用,并初步探讨其机制。方法将160只SD雄性大鼠按随机数字表法分为谷氨酰胺联合维生素C组、谷氨酰胺组、维生素C组、高温应激组、正常对照组。用人工气候箱建立大鼠中暑内毒素血症模型,分别于1、3、7、15 d用2%的戊巴比妥钠腹腔麻醉取小肠组织并心脏采血。用试剂盒检测小肠组织超氧化物歧化酶(SOD)、丙二醛(MDA)及血清内毒素的含量,RT-PCR检测小肠黏膜Toll样受体2(TLR2)mRNA表达情况。结果在同时间段与正常对照组比,高温应激组SOD含量明显降低,MDA、血清内毒素、TLR2mRNA表达量明显升高(P<0.05),3种治疗组SOD、MDA含量无统计学差异(P>0.05),谷氨酰胺组、维生素C组血清内毒素及TLR2 mRNA表达量明显升高(P<0.05),但谷氨酰胺组联合维生素C组血清内毒素及TLR2 mRNA表达量无统计学差异(P>0.05)。在同时间段与高温应激组相比,3种治疗组SOD含量显著升高(除第7天谷氨酰胺组、维生素C组外);MDA、内毒素含量及TLR2 mRNA表达量明显降低(除第3天、第15天的维生素C组TLR2 mRNA表达量外)(P<0.05)。同时间段的谷氨酰胺联合维生素C组与谷氨酰胺组、维生素C组相比,其SOD含量相近,但MDA和血清内毒素含量及TLR2 mRNA表达量均显著降低(P<0.05)。结论谷氨酰胺联合维生素C可减轻高热应激对肠黏膜的损伤,保护肠黏膜屏障功能,有效的降低肠源性内毒素血症发生,可用于高热中暑的预防。Objective To observe the preventive effect of pretreatment of glutamine combined with vitamin C on intestinal endotoxemia,and to investigate the mechanism in heat stroke prevention.Methods One-hundred-and-sixty male SD rats were randomly divided into a glutamine and vitamin C group,a glutamine group,a vitamin C group,a heat stress group,and a normal control group.A rat model of heat stroke-induced endotoxemia was built using an artificial climate chamber.At 1,3,7 and 15 d after heat stroke,the small intestine tissues and heart blood of the rats were collected after intraperitoneal anesthesia with 2% sodium pentobarbital.The levels of superoxide dismutase(SOD) and malondialdehyde(MDA) in small intestine tissues and serum endotoxin level were measured using test kits.The mRNA expression of Toll-like receptor 2(TLR2) in small intestine mucosa was tested by RT-PCR.Results Compared with the normal control group,SOD level decreased,while MDA level,serum endotoxin level,and TLR2 mRNA expression increased significantly in the heat stress group(P0.05).There were no statistical differences in SOD level and MDA level between the three treatment groups and the normal control group.Compared with the normal control group,serum endotoxin level and TLR2 mRNA expression increased significantly in the glutamine group and vitamin C group(P0.05),but had no statistical differences in the glutamine and vitamin C group.Compared with the heat stress group,SOD level increased significantly in the three treatment groups(except for the glutamine group and vitamin C group at 7 d after heat stress),while MDA level,serum endotoxin level,and TLR2 mRNA expre-ssion decreased significantly(except for TLR2 mRNA expression in the vitamin C group at 3 d and 15 d after heat stress)(P0.05).Compared with the glutamine group and vitamin C group,SOD level was similar in the glutamine and vitamin C group,but MDA level,serum endotoxin level,and TLR2 mRNA expression decreased significantly(P0.05).Conclusion Glutamine comb
